Hochul Picks Fmr Council Speaker Adrienne Adams as Running Mate in All-Female Gubernatorial Ticket

Editor’s Note: The following is an extended and updated version of the story that appears in our latest print edition.

New York Gov. Kathy Hochul has picked former New York City Council Speaker Adrienne Adams as her running mate in her upcoming bid to win reelection later this year in the New York Democratic Primary. As reported, Adams most recently ran (unsuccessfully) for mayor, visiting Norwood, at least twice, after announcing her run for mayor.

The all-female ticket is a gubernatorial first. As reported, the Bronx made history as the first New York City borough to be led by two women when Borough President Vanessa Gibson chose now former Deputy Borough President Janet Peguero as her running mate…
